Get more details with Fine Resolution
Fine Resolution is a technology that restores the details originally
inherent to the object while enhancing the resolution, at the
same time minimizing fuzziness and noise. It is accomplished by
performing sophisticated calculations on continuous multi-frames
of the image – evaluated for misalignment caused mainly by hand
tremor. The firmware then detects and corrects the information
between images through one feature pixel.
With Fine Resolution,
Get an effective 320 x 240 pixels of radiometric JPEG IR image
which is clearer and sharper.
See fine details on objects as close as 10 cm, especially when
measuring temperature on small components which are close to
each other.
With 4x digital zoom, magnify a thermal image of a far-away
objects quickly to identify anomalies and to reveal even finer
details.
These are essential for industrial, building inspection, electronics,
as well as medical research.

Perform more in-camera measurements
and analysis
Capture thermal images effectively with its intuitive and easy to
use tools:
Configurable quick access buttons that are able to change
functions based on user preference.
Monitor temperature trends over time for quality checks when
monitoring process parameters in industrial plant automation.
Perform analysis using its extensive range of measurement tools.
Coupled with the U5855A’s high sensitivity of 0.07 °C, it can
detect the slightest temperature difference to provide more
accurate temperature readings.
